Addition cover thickness in reinforced cement concrete members totally immersed in seawater is-

Detailed Solution: Question 10

For reinforced concrete members totally immersed in seawater, the cover shall be 40 mm more than that.

For reinforced concrete members, periodically immersed in seawater or subject to sea spray, the cover of concrete shall be 50 mm more than that.

For concrete of grade M 25 and above, the additional thickness of cover specified above may be reduced to half. In all such cases, the cover should not exceed 75 mm.

In a flow field, the streamlines, and equipotential lines-

Detailed Solution: Question 24

Concept:

Stream line is an imaginary curve drawn through a flowing fluid in such a way so that the tangents to it at any point gives the direction of the instantaneous velocity of flow at that point.
Equipotential lines are formed by joining the different points having the same value of velocity potential function.

Properties: 

Slope of equipotential Line × Slope of stream function = -1
i.e. streamlines and equipotential lines always meet orthogonally.
Meshes formed by them may be in square, rectangular or curvilinear.

For controlling the growth of algae, the chemical generally used is:

Detailed Solution: Question 29

Algae are microscopic free-floating plants that play an important role in aquatic ecosystems and directly affect the health of these systems. Through their photosynthetic processes, algae use carbon dioxide, converting it to organic matter and oxygen.
  • Algae are important sources of dissolved oxygen in a water impoundment and constitute the basic building blocks of the aquatic food chain

  • They cause water quality problems only when they proliferate so much that they upset the ecological balance

  • Copper sulfate is frequently used for algal control, and sometimes it is applied on a routine basis during summer months, whether or not it is actually needed

Note: Alum is used as a coagulant in the coagulation process.
